Capacity note for review: the flaky DNS resolution in the Tallowmere batch tier traces to resolver pool exhaustion under burst fan-out. We now cache positive answers longer, cap in-flight lookups per worker, and fail fast to the secondary resolver instead of queueing. Retry jitter prevents synchronized storms. The resolver tuning constants proposed in this change are shown below.

tuning table, yajog-yahof:
BUDGETS = {
    "lamvan": 303,
    "wenox": 460,
    "fenvan": 525,
}

Off-site run — item 4: Crate of survey instruments for the Pellbrook ridge team. It's the grey flight case with the orange latches, sitting by bay two. Heavier than it looks, so grab the trolley. Foam inserts are already packed; don't open it to check, the theodolites are calibrated. Drop is the Fennic Outpost gate, morning window. Follow the hand-over line below word for word:

handover note for yagef-bagep: the drudor pelius courier leaves the kasdor zorvan norir ledger at gate 8016 under passcode 755406

## Ticket: Webhook retries failing after credential expiry

Several Hollowgate customers report missed webhook deliveries. Root cause: the delivery worker's credential expired last Tuesday, and our retry logic treats 401s as permanent failures, so events were dropped rather than requeued. A fix to reclassify 401s as retryable is in review. Meanwhile, support can manually replay dropped events through the Relaypost admin API using the rotated key below.

gateway credential: kto23_LX9A4ys6i4nzHtpOLNLodKK

Ticket: Config drift in Relayfield calendar sync. The staging node resolves overlapping-event conflicts by last-writer-wins, while production still uses source-priority, causing mirrored meetings to duplicate after each sync cycle. Future maintainers: the drift began after the Harven migration and was never reconciled. For reference, the current production values are reproduced below.

deployment values, hahip-kajep:
HOLAX_PIN=4003
HOLAX_METRICS_HOST=metrics.holax.zemvarworks.internal
HOLAX_LOG_LEVEL=warn
HOLAX_TENANT=fraael